Roots and Rocks: Building Resilience through Outdoor Climbing

What You'll Experience

  • Warm Welcome & Gear Fitting – cozy coffee circle, harness demo.

  • Immersive Forest Therapy Walk – sensory reset on the approach trail.

  • Scaling Internal & External Walls – guided climbs with therapist framing.

  • Stress-Management Toolkit – physiological sigh, curiosity cue-cards.

  • Reflection Hike & Gratitude Circle – anchor insights before departure.

Who It's For

Adults & teens managing anxiety, stress, trauma, or low self-esteem who want an active, nature-based route to healing. No climbing experience required.

Peace in the Wild Retreat

At Peace in the Wild, we understand that peace is not the absence of struggle; it’s the ability to remain rooted and responsive in the face of life’s challenges. This immersive retreat combines the restorative power of nature with evidence-based practices in resilience building, positive psychology, and post-traumatic growth.

​Grounded in material drawn from global resilience training models, including those used by the United Nations, this retreat supports participants in cultivating the inner strengths that promote healing, adaptability, and a renewed sense of purpose. With the wild landscapes of Western Maryland as both backdrop and co-facilitator, our skilled team of therapists and guides offers a space for reflection, learning, and deep connection.

​Participants explore practices that awaken joy, self-compassion, meaning, and courage, moving beyond survival toward authentic flourishing.
